Output 69421398e339a3a2998bd5a618f698e056a9d5c4d7e3cbcbc6740cf05673644b:0

value
58404531
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d484be186843756e28d4de5b74498356a572430 OP_EQUALVERIFY OP_CHECKSIG
address
12DEPjiLQrh5dJKcjfRTiEof6Z1fXjoDqJ
transaction
69421398e339a3a2998bd5a618f698e056a9d5c4d7e3cbcbc6740cf05673644b
spent
true